服务器上传大内存还是大硬盘
- 行业动态
- 2025-02-20
- 2
服务器的内存和硬盘是其运行的核心组件,它们各自承担着不同的任务,对服务器的性能有着至关重要的影响,以下是关于服务器内存与硬盘的详细比较:
1、存储性质与用途
内存(RAM):作为临时存储介质,内存用于存储当前正在运行的程序和数据,是实现服务器运行速度优化的关键,当服务器启动时,操作系统、应用程序以及相关的服务和进程会被加载到内存中供CPU快速访问,在处理客户端请求时,Web服务器会将相关的网页数据、脚本文件等暂时存储在内存中,以便快速响应用户的访问请求。
硬盘:属于永久性存储介质,主要用于长期保存数据,包括操作系统、应用程序、数据库以及用户数据等,即使服务器关闭或断电,硬盘中的数据仍然可以长期保留,比如企业的业务数据、用户上传的文件等都存储在硬盘上,以便随时读取和使用。
2、读写速度
内存:读写速度非常快,通常以纳秒计算,这使得CPU能够迅速访问和处理内存中的数据,大大提高了服务器的响应速度和处理能力,在高性能计算场景下,如科学计算、金融交易等,快速的内存读写速度可以确保数据的及时处理和分析。
硬盘:读写速度相对较慢,传统机械硬盘(HDD)受磁盘旋转速度和磁头移动速度的限制,其读写速度一般在几十MB/s到几百MB/s之间;固态硬盘(SSD)虽然速度较快,但与传统内存相比仍有较大差距,不过相比机械硬盘已经有了显著提升,可达到几百MB/s到数GB/s的读写速度。
3、容量
内存:容量一般较小,通常以GB为单位计量,常见的服务器内存容量有4GB、8GB、16GB、32GB、64GB等,一些高端服务器可能会配备更大容量的内存,如128GB甚至更高,但成本也相应增加。
硬盘:容量较大,通常以TB为单位计量,从几百GB到数TB不等,甚至可以达到数十TB或更高,随着技术的发展,硬盘的容量还在不断增加,以满足企业对大量数据存储的需求。
4、数据安全
内存:由于内存是易失性存储器,当服务器断电或重启时,内存中的数据会丢失,内存主要用于临时存储运行时的数据和程序,不适合长期保存重要数据。
硬盘:作为非易失性存储器,硬盘中的数据在断电后仍然可以长期保留,具有较高的数据安全性,为了进一步提高数据的安全性,还可以通过备份等方式对硬盘中的数据进行保护。
5、价格
内存:价格相对较高,尤其是大容量、高频率的内存模块,因为内存的制造工艺复杂,且需要与CPU等其他硬件紧密配合,所以其成本较高。
硬盘:价格相对较低,特别是传统的机械硬盘,单位存储成本较低,但随着硬盘技术的发展,如固态硬盘的出现,其价格也在逐渐下降,同时性能也在不断提高。
6、应用场景
内存:适用于需要高速数据交换和处理的应用,如在线游戏服务器、实时数据处理系统、高性能计算平台等,在这些场景下,快速的内存读写速度可以保证数据的及时处理和系统的流畅运行。
硬盘:适用于数据存储、备份和归档等任务,特别是需要大容量存储空间的应用,如数据中心、企业资源规划(ERP)系统、视频监控系统等,在这些场景下,硬盘的大容量存储可以满足大量数据的长期保存需求。
服务器的内存和硬盘在存储性质、读写速度、容量、数据安全、价格等方面存在明显差异,在选择服务器配置时,需要根据具体的应用需求来合理分配内存和硬盘资源,以达到最佳的性能和成本效益平衡,如果服务器需要处理大量的并发请求和实时数据,那么应该配备较大的内存;如果服务器需要存储大量的数据和文件,那么应该选择容量较大的硬盘。
本站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本站,有问题联系侵删!
本文链接:http://www.xixizhuji.com/fuzhu/144283.html